Robert Haarde got 1,350 and Robert Stein garnered 831 votes.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>Marshall replaces Eric Harris, who chose not to run again.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>Voters re-elected Susan Iuliano and Jeffrey Beeler to three-year terms on the Sudbury School Committee. Iuliano received 1,464 votes, Beeler, 1,269, while Tammie Rhodes Dufault received 1,136.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>All the results are unofficial.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>With the nation in a recession, School Committee races took first place in importance to residents interviewed at the polls.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>Christos Cassandras said schools were most important to him, particularly Lincoln-Sudbury Regional High School, where his son will be a student in the fall. Before casting his vote, Cassandras attended the L-S open house, talked to parents and listened to candidates.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>In the race for a three-year slot on the Board of Health, registered nurse Linda Marie Huet-Clayton defeated Dr. Anil M. Vyas. Clayton received 986 votes, compared to Vyas&#8217; 612.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>Voter turnout was lower than previous years.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>&#8220;There were no ballot questions that draws voters out,&#8221; said Assistant Town Clerk Judy Newton. Of the more than 11,462 registered voters, 2,407, or 21 percent, in Sudbury went to the polls. That&#8217;s compared to a 38 percent turnout in 2008, and 46 percent in 2002.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>At 11:45 a.m., Precinct 1, with the highest votes, tallied a mere 161.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>&#8220;From what I&#8217;ve heard from the check in and check out, weather was a factor this morning,&#8221; Newton said. There were more voters this afternoon.&#8221;<\/P><br \/>\n<P>In the uncontested races, retaining their three-year-term seats are: Lawrence O&#8217;Brien, Board of Selectmen; Joshua Fox Board of Assessors; Jill Browne and Lily Gordon, Goodnow Library trustees; Myron Fox, moderator; and Christopher Morely and Eric Poch, Planning Board. Sherrill Cline kept her five-year seat on the Sudbury Housing Authority.<\/P><br \/>\n<P>Two three-year terms remain unfilled on the Parks and Recreation Commission because no one ran.<\/P><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Voters yesterday kept Mark Collins on the Lincoln-Sudbury Regional School Committee and elected newcomer Nancy Marshall of Lincoln to the same board.
